CPL24 vs CTB20 vs CTB26 - pls help me decide by Mios04 in EVERGOODS

[–]HorizonMan 0 points1 point  (0 children)

I’ve done that scenario, and IMHO the CTB 26 is much better for it than the CPL. I also find it much more comfortable to wear than the CPL but that seems to vary from person to person. We were just raveling and my wife had the CPL and I had the CTB, her bag felt like it weighed more on my back than mine even though mine actually weighed more. I also really like that front dump pocket. I haven’t used the CTB 20 to say it would be big enough, but I suspect it‘s a close, but might be tight.

untreated muscle fibre tear by [deleted] in BALLET

[–]HorizonMan 1 point2 points  (0 children)

If it happened in 2024 the tear has surely healed, so the orthopedist is probably right it's scar tissue, and perhaps the injury just wasn't properly rehabbed in the first place.

An orthopedic surgeon isn't the person to get rehab advice from. Their job is to operate, which is highly skilled and requires a lot of training and knowledge, it's a bit much to expect them to also be great physiotherapists. Since the orthopedist gave you the clearance, you're probably better off finding a good physiotherapist and working on rehab. They will give you specific exercises to lead you to recovery.

Thoughts on Arc'teryx Therme Down Parka for Norwegian winter? by Emotional_Spite_6007 in arcteryx

[–]HorizonMan 0 points1 point  (0 children)

I had the Therme for one day. Living in Helsinki, and generally closer to 0° C, t was too warm and too stiff for me. But now that we are having a cold snap, at -15 and below I think it would be perfect. I returned it and went for the Ralle Parka instead, it's a more versatile option here where we get a lot of 0° drizzle.
